California ends pass-on antitrust defence

Premium Article - Wednesday, 14 July 2010

The California Supreme Court has ruled that the state’s legislature did not intend for the Cartwright Act – California’s antitrust law – to allow alleged cartelists to use a pass-on defence to thwart private lawsuits.

FTC clears Pfizer/Wyeth with conditions

Premium Article - Wednesday, 14 October 2009

Pfizer gets US clearance for Wyeth buy
US drug makers Pfizer and Wyeth have agreed to sell half of Wyeth’s animal health business to end the Federal Trade Commission’s long-running investigation of their US$68 billion merger.
